Blog

Components of SEO

Day 2: The Three Pillars of SEO – On-Page, Off-Page, and Technical SEO

Today, we’re building on our SEO foundation by exploring its three main components: On-Page SEO, Off-Page SEO, and Technical SEO. Understanding these areas is essential for mastering SEO and improving your website’s visibility on search engines.

1. On-Page SEO

On-Page SEO refers to optimising individual pages on your website to rank higher and earn more relevant traffic in search engines. It focuses on both the content and HTML source code of a page. Here are the key elements of On-Page SEO:

Keywords: Properly researched keywords are the backbone of On-Page SEO. Using the right keywords in titles, meta descriptions, headers, and throughout your content helps search engines understand what your page is about.

Meta Tags: These include your meta title and meta description. They should be concise, keyword-rich, and clearly describe the content on the page.

Header Tags: These help organize your content and make it easier for search engines to understand. Use H1 for the main title and H2/H3 for subheadings.

Internal Links: Linking to other pages on your site helps users and search engines navigate your content and understand its structure.

Image Optimization: Use descriptive filenames, ALT tags, and ensure your images are compressed for faster load times.

2. Off-Page SEO

Off-Page SEO is about building your website’s reputation and authority in the eyes of search engines. This is largely accomplished through link-building strategies, but it also includes other external signals that tell search engines your site is valuable and trustworthy.

Backlinks: The number and quality of backlinks (links from other websites to yours) are a key ranking factor. The more high-authority sites that link to you, the more credible your site becomes.

Social Media Engagement: While not a direct ranking factor, social signals like shares, likes, and comments can drive traffic to your site, boosting your SEO indirectly.

Brand Mentions: Unlinked brand mentions across the web can help establish your site’s authority, even if no link is present.

Building Off-Page SEO requires outreach efforts, relationship building, and quality content that others will want to link to.

3. Technical SEO

Technical SEO refers to optimising your website’s infrastructure so that search engines can easily crawl, index, and rank your pages. It ensures that your site meets the technical requirements of search engines to improve organic rankings.

Site Speed: A slow website negatively affects user experience and search rankings. Tools like Google PageSpeed Insights can help you measure and improve your site’s speed.

Mobile Optimization: With Google’s mobile-first indexing, it’s critical that your site is mobile-friendly. Ensure your site is responsive and performs well on all devices.

Crawling and Indexing: Make sure search engines can easily crawl and index your site. Use tools like Google Search Console to monitor your indexing status and spot potential issues.

SSL Certificate (HTTPS): Having a secure site (HTTPS) is now a ranking factor, so ensure you have an SSL certificate installed.

Structured Data: Implement structured data (or schema markup) to help search engines better understand the content on your pages. This can enhance search results with rich snippets.

4. Local SEO (Bonus)

Local SEO is crucial for businesses that operate in specific geographical areas. It helps your business appear in local searches (e.g., “restaurants near me”) and Google’s Local Pack. Key elements of Local SEO include:

Google My Business: Create and optimize your Google My Business listing to appear in local search results and maps.

NAP (Name, Address, Phone Number): Ensure consistency of your business’s name, address, and phone number across your website and all online directories.

Local Keywords: Use keywords with local intent (e.g., “Brighton café”) to optimize your site for local searches.

Conclusion

Understanding these three core components—On-Page SEO, Off-Page SEO, and Technical SEO—is the foundation of a successful SEO strategy. By mastering these pillars, you’ll set yourself up for long-term growth and improved search engine rankings.

Tomorrow, we’ll dive deeper into how to measure and track your SEO performance to ensure you’re making progress. Keep up the great work on your SEO journey!

Leave a Reply

Your email address will not be published. Required fields are marked *